10" Green Lantern + Kim Possible


GL in Packaging

The first wave of 10? Justice League Action Figures includes Batman, Superman, Flash and Green Lantern. Originally many people thought that Green Lantern wasn?t shipping and perhaps he was cancelled. What really happened was that the first cases included 2 Supermans, 1 Batman, and 1 Flash. After those cases shipped, Flash was replaced with Green Lantern, and Batman was packed at 2 per case.


Green Lantern

I?m not going to go into a detailed review over this figure since I?ve already reviewed the other three. In general everything that applies to the other figures applies here. On my Green Lantern the paint application was a bit sloppy, but not a huge problem. You might want to wait a bit and be picky about the paint job if this bugs you.


Kim Vs GL

On a completely unrelated note, I also picked up a Super Bendy Magnetic Kim Possible at the same time I picked up Green Lantern. All you have to know is that it?s really cool and a lot of fun. She has magnets in her hands and feet, which allow for some crazy unbalanced poses. She?s sort of in scale with the 10? Justice League line, and if you?re a fan of Kim, you?ll be a fan of the toy. I found both of the toys for $10 at Walmart.
